    Ah, V1 has its limitations...

    But you should be able to do "connect under reset" also "manually" - hold the NRST line low, while attempting to connect. If it does not work, you have a serious problem.

    Is the original target (the STM8) disconnected? Do you use a short cable to connect to the STM32 target?
